Default Rear Seat Belt Buckles.

I need to replace the front seat belt buckle red plastic buttons in my 1992 940.
I believe that those fitted to my early 940 are the same shape as those fitted to the 700 series and that later models of the 940 had a slightly different shape which of course would not fit.
I am requesting buckles from the rear seat on the assumption that they will have received considerably less wear.
Does anyone have any surplus to their requirements please?
